By Breaking Belize News Staff (HP): An 18-year-old man is in police custody after he was found in possession of suspected cannabis during a late-night patrol in Orange Walk Town.
Police report that around 10:45 p.m. on Friday, January 24, 2026, officers were conducting mobile patrols along Cardinal Street when their attention was drawn to a group of individuals walking toward the marked police vehicle. One male dressed in black was approached by officers.
Police informed the individual that a search would be conducted for illegal drugs and firearms. During the search of a white and black Jordan-branded bag, officers discovered a transparent plastic bag containing a green leafy substance suspected to be cannabis.
The individual was informed of the offense and escorted to the Orange Walk Police Station along with the suspected drugs.
At the station, he was identified as Ayden Perez, an 18-year-old laborer of Mammey Street, Trial Farm Village. Police say he was informed of his rights, completed the required custody records, and signed the acknowledgment forms.
The suspected cannabis was weighed in his presence and amounted to 117 grams. The substance was sealed, labeled, and handed over to the exhibit keeper.
Perez remains in custody pending formal charges.
